Created in 2009, Blue Line Sterilization Services has been focused to reducing the time to market for innovators engineering new medical devices. The company distinguishes itself by maintaining a bank of 8 cubic foot ethylene oxide (EO) sterilizers, providing FDA and EU compliant sterilization with turnaround times of 1 to 3 days—an achievement beyond capability with larger EO sterilization services.

Co-founders Brant and Jane Gard acknowledged the important need for accelerated sterilization options, particularly for rapid development programs innovating innovative medical devices. The ability to swiftly navigate through device iterations is essential in reducing the need for additional funding, preserving the value of investors' equity, and expediting time to market. Faster service and reduced time to market hold great value for employees, investors, and the patients benefiting from improved medical care.

Moreover routine sterilization, Blue Line offers rapid turnkey validations and small batch releases that support clinical trials and FDA/CE submissions. Reasons Medical Device Sterilization is Essential

Mitigation of infections remains a essential aspect of modern medicine. The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) estimate that around 1 in 31 hospital patients experiences at least one healthcare-associated infection (HAI). Appropriate sterilization of medical devices greatly reduces the risk of these infections, safeguarding patients and healthcare providers equally. Substandard sterilization can give rise to outbreaks of serious diseases like hepatitis, HIV, and antibiotic-resistant bacterial infections.

Approaches to Medical Device Sterilization

The science behind sterilization has evolved dramatically over the last century, utilizing a variety of methods suited to diverse types of devices and materials. Some of the most regularly applied techniques include:

Autoclaving (Steam Sterilization)

Autoclaving remains the most common and trusted method of sterilization, particularly suitable for surgical instruments and reusable metal devices. Using high-pressure saturated steam at temperatures around 121–134°C, autoclaving effectively kills bacteria, viruses, fungi, and spores. State-of-the-art Materials and Device Complexity

The growth of high-tech medical devices—such as robotic surgery instruments and intricate diagnostic equipment—demands sterilization approaches capable of handling delicate materials. Advancements in sterilization include methods including low-temperature plasma sterilization and hydrogen peroxide vapor, which can sterilize without damaging vulnerable components.
